About
A heterocyclic hair-dye intermediate restricted under EU Annex III. Permitted at strict concentrations but flagged for skin and respiratory sensitisation — patch testing is recommended before each use.
Skin benefits
- Functions as a hair dye intermediate under EU Annex III restrictions
Known concerns
- Skin and respiratory sensitisation potential
- Requires strict purity and concentration controls
- Permitted only in hair dye products, not for skin contact products
